A BRACE BY CARRASCO AND ONE GOAL BY FILIPE LUIS BEAT OSASUNA

We keep on adding

Atlético de Madrid added another win against Osasuna thanks to two goals by Carrasco and one by Filipe Luis. Sirigu saved two penalties in the final minutes, one shot by Carrasco and another by Thomas.

ATLÉTICO 3-0 OSASUNA
 

Atlético de Madrid: Oblak; Juanfran, Godín, Lucas, Filipe Luis (Savic, 67’); Nico Gaitán (Cerci, 75’), Thomas, Giménez, Carrasco; Correa and Fernando Torres (Tiago, 71’).

Osasuna: Sirigu; Olavide (De las Cuevas, 57’), Oier, David García, Fuentes, Clerc (Aitor Buñuel, 57’); Fausto Tienza (Roberto Torres, 76’), Causic, Berenguer; Sergio León and Kenan.

Referee: Melero López. Booked the home player Giménez (25’); and the visiting Kenan (43’), Oier (54’), Sirigu (88’) and De las Cuevas (89’).

GOALS:
1-0. 30'. Carrasco scores in personal play after dribbling two players and finishing close to Sirigu's right post.
2-0. 47'. Carrasco heads into the net a measured cross from Nico Gaitán.
3-0. 61'. Filipe Luis scores with the right after and assist from Correa.

An Atlético de Madrid with differences to the last match resolved efficiently the match against Osasuna. And did so with three brilliant goals. The first one was scored by Carrasco at the half hour mark, similar to the one he scored against Valencia last season, making two dribbles and sending the ball into the net next to the post. Later, Carrasco scored again just as the second half began, with a header to a cross by Gaitán. And Filipe Luis, who is on a roll scoring goals (three in the last four League games), closed the match with a right footer.

The truth is that we scored three but it could have been more because Torres also had his opportunities, saved by Sirigu, as well as Correa and Thomas. We had time to see Cerci’s League debut and Tiago's return after his injury. Children’s Day was a party for the youngest and for an Atlético de Madrid that has another exciting match on Tuesday in the second leg of the Champions quarter-finals against Leicester. There were even two penalties in the final minutes, both saved by Sirigu, one shot by Carrasco and other by Thomas.
